Keeping Your Threshold Smooth: A Comprehensive Guide to Patio Door Repairs
Patio doors are more than just entryways; they are gateways to the outdoors, seamlessly mixing interior living areas with gardens, decks, and patios. They welcome natural light and fresh air into our homes, improve visual appeal, and offer convenient access to outdoor areas. Nevertheless, like any regularly used function in a home, patio doors are prone to use and tear, establishing problems that can jeopardize their performance, security, and energy performance.

Comprehending common Patio Door Screen Repair door problems and understanding how to resolve them is important for house owners. Ignoring repairs can lead to more substantial damage, higher energy bills, and security vulnerabilities. This short article provides a thorough guide to patio door repairs, covering common concerns, DIY repairs, when to call a professional, and preventative upkeep pointers to guarantee your patio doors glide efficiently for many years to come.

Comprehending the Types of Patio Doors

Before diving into repairs, it's useful to understand the different kinds of patio doors commonly discovered in homes. Each type has its own set of prospective problems and repair factors to consider:
Sliding Patio Doors: This is the most prevalent type, defined by 2 or more panels that slide horizontally along tracks. They are space-saving and easy to run when in excellent condition.Hinged Patio Doors (French Doors): Resembling traditional doors, French patio doors swing inward or external on hinges. They offer a timeless visual and a wider opening.Folding Patio Doors (Bi-fold Doors): These doors consist of multiple panels that fold and stack versus each other when opened, producing a vast opening. They are perfect for optimizing indoor-outdoor circulation.Telescoping Patio Doors: Similar to sliding doors, telescoping doors feature numerous panels that slide and stack in a single direction, permitting for a wider opening than basic Sliding Patio Door Repairs doors.
Understanding the type of patio door you have will help you much better comprehend the specific components and potential repair needs.

Common Patio Door Problems: A Troubleshooter's Guide

Patio Door Seal Repair doors, regardless of their robust building and construction, undergo different problems gradually. Here are a few of the most typical issues homeowners encounter:
Difficulty Sliding or Sticking: This is a regular complaint with sliding patio doors. The door may end up being tough to open or close smoothly, typically accompanied by grinding noises.Off-Track Doors: Sometimes, sliding doors can jump off their tracks completely, becoming unusable and possibly harming the door frame or rollers.Damaged Rollers: Rollers are crucial for the smooth operation of sliding doors. Use and tear, dirt accumulation, or damage to the rollers can trigger friction and impede motion.Worn or Damaged Weather Stripping: Weather stripping seals the gaps around the door to avoid drafts, water leakages, and insect invasion. Deteriorated weather removing compromises energy effectiveness and convenience.Broken or Loose Handles and Locks: Handles and locks are important for security and ease of usage. Damage or loosening in these parts can affect both performance and security.Split or Foggy Glass Panes: Over time, glass panes can break due to effect or stress. Fogging between panes in double-pane windows suggests seal failure, lowering insulation.Distorted or Damaged Frames: Exposure to weather aspects, settling foundations, or inappropriate installation can cause patio door frames to warp or end up being harmed, resulting in operational issues.Screen Door Issues: If your patio door has a screen, problems like torn mesh, bent frames, or malfunctioning rollers and locks are also common.
Do It Yourself Patio Door Repairs: When to Take Matters Into Your Own Hands

Numerous small patio door concerns can be taken on with DIY abilities and easily offered tools. Knowing when you can deal with the repair yourself can save you money and time. Here are some DIY-friendly repairs:
Lubricating Tracks and Rollers: For sliding doors that are sticking, cleaning and lubing the tracks and rollers is typically the very first and simplest action. Utilize a wire brush to remove debris from the tracks and use a silicone-based lube to both tracks and rollers.Adjusting Rollers: Many sliding patio doors have adjustable rollers. Locating the change screws (frequently on the door's edge near the rollers) and utilizing a screwdriver to somewhat raise or reduce the rollers can improve smooth sliding.Changing Weather Stripping: Weather stripping is fairly economical and simple to replace. Purchase replacement weather condition removing from a hardware store, get rid of the old stripping, clean the surface area, and apply the brand-new removing, making sure a tight seal.Tightening Up Loose Screws and Handles: Loose manages or screws around the door frame are easy fixes. Use a screwdriver to tighten any loose fasteners.Changing Rollers (Simple Cases): If you can recognize the specific kind of roller utilized in your door, replacement rollers are frequently offered at hardware shops. Changing rollers can include removing the door panel, accessing the rollers, and setting up the brand-new ones. Caution is required here as door panels can be heavy.Minor Screen Door Repairs: Small tears in screen mesh can be patched with screen repair tape. Bent screen frames may be gently aligned. Screen door rollers and locks can sometimes be cleaned and lubed or replaced if broken.
When to Call a Professional Patio Door Repair Service

While DIY repairs can be reliable for small problems, specific issues require the proficiency and tools of an expert patio door repair service. It's Best Patio Door Repairs to call a professional when you encounter:
Off-Track Doors (Especially Repeatedly): If your sliding door frequently leaps off its track, it might indicate a more considerable issue like a distorted frame, harmed tracks, or severely misaligned rollers that require expert assessment and repair.Broken Glass Panes: Replacing glass panes, particularly in double-pane windows, needs specialized abilities and devices to ensure proper sealing and avoid damage to the door frame. It's essential to call a glass repair or door specialist.Distorted or Damaged Frames: Frame repairs, particularly if warping is significant or there's structural damage, are best left to professionals. They can examine the extent of the damage and carry out essential repairs or frame replacements.Lock and Security System Issues: If you are experiencing problems with patio door locks or security systems that you can not easily deal with, it's crucial to call a professional locksmith or door repair service to ensure your home's security is not jeopardized.Complex Roller or Hardware Replacements: For more complex roller replacement procedures or if you are uncertain about the correct parts or procedure, expert assistance is suggested. Inaccurate installation can trigger further damage or security issues.Water Leaks and Drafts Persist After DIY Attempts: If drafts and water leakages persist after replacing weather condition stripping or trying other DIY repairs, there may be underlying issues needing expert medical diagnosis and repair.
The Cost of Patio Door Repairs: Factors to Consider

The expense of patio door repairs can vary commonly depending on the type of repair required, the type of Patio Door Installation door, the degree of the damage, and labor expenses in your area. Here are some elements that influence repair costs:
Type of Repair: Simple repairs like track lubrication or weather stripping replacement are relatively affordable, costing from a few dollars for materials to under ₤ 100 for DIY or a fundamental service call if expertly dealt with. More complex repairs like roller replacement, frame modifications, or glass replacement will be considerably more costly.Door Type: French doors and folding patio doors often have more complicated hardware and mechanisms, which can result in greater repair expenses compared to fundamental sliding doors.Parts and Materials: The expense of replacement parts, like rollers, manages, weather stripping, or glass panes, will contribute to the total repair expense. Specialized parts for older or less typical door types may be more expensive or harder to source.Labor Costs: Professional labor rates vary by area and the expertise of the repair service. Expect to pay a hourly rate or a flat charge for the service call and labor time.Emergency Repairs: Emergency repairs, such as protecting a broken door or resolving a security issue instantly, typically incur higher expenses due to after-hours service or expedited reaction.

Preventative Maintenance: Keeping Your Patio Doors in Top Shape

Regular maintenance is key to avoiding major patio door issues and extending their life-span. Include these preventative steps into your routine:
Regular Cleaning: Clean the tracks of sliding doors regularly to remove dirt, debris, and animal hair that can obstruct roller motion. Use a vacuum or a stiff brush.Lubrication: Lubricate tracks and rollers with a silicone-based lubricant a few times a year, particularly before and after seasons of heavy use.Check Weather Stripping: Inspect weather condition stripping every year for indications of wear, fractures, or damage. Replace worn stripping without delay.Check and Tighten Hardware: Periodically check handles, locks, and screws for looseness and tighten them as required.Screen Roller Condition: Visually examine rollers for damage or wear. Attend to any issues early before they cause more significant problems.Keep Tracks Clear of Obstructions: Avoid putting objects that could obstruct the tracks of sliding doors, and cut back any plants that may rub versus the door or frame.Address Minor Issues Promptly: Don't overlook minor issues like sticky sliding or loose handles. Resolving them early can avoid them from escalating into more expensive repairs.
By understanding patio door repair basics, understanding when to DIY and when to call a professional, and practicing preventative maintenance, you can keep your patio doors operating smoothly, enhancing your home's comfort, security, and aesthetic appeal for many years to come.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s) about Patio Door Repairs

Q: How often should I oil my patio door tracks?A: It's advised to oil patio door tracks at least twice a year, or more frequently if you notice the door ending up being hard to slide. Seasons with heavy usage or extreme weather may call for more frequent lubrication.

Q: Can I replace patio door rollers myself?A: Yes, oftentimes, replacing rollers is a DIY-friendly job. Nevertheless, it depends on your convenience level with home repairs, the complexity of your door's roller system, and the availability of replacement rollers. If you're uncertain, it's best to consult a professional.

Q: How much does it cost to replace weather condition stripping on a patio door?A: Weather stripping is reasonably inexpensive. Products can cost from ₤ 10 to ₤ 30, depending upon the length and type. If you hire an expert, labor costs will contribute to this, however it is still generally an affordable repair.

Q: My patio door glass is foggy. Can it be repaired?A: Foggy glass generally indicates seal failure in a double-pane window. Most of the times, the glass pane needs to be replaced. While some specialized services provide defogging, replacement is usually more reputable and lasting.

Q: How do I understand if my patio door frame is distorted?A: Signs of a deformed frame consist of difficulty opening and closing the door, unequal gaps around the door, drafts, and the door not sitting directly in the frame. Professional evaluation is generally needed to verify and deal with frame warping.

Q: Is it worth repairing an old patio door, or should I replace it?A: Whether to repair or replace depends upon the age and total condition of the door, the extent of the damage, and the expense of repairs versus replacement. If the door is extremely old, significantly damaged, or repairs are extensive and costly, replacement may be a more affordable long-term service, especially thinking about energy efficiency enhancements in brand-new doors. Get quotes for both repair and replacement to make a notified decision.
